[QUOTE="gss000, post: 7947329, member: 7016012"] I wouldn't look at list rankings like that. Amazon changes what's on each ranking from time to time. I would look more at absolute rankings based on a combination of daily sales and monthly sales, according to one site that translates ranks into book sales. It's not the first time. It's been there before, but I think it's been riding high after the last holiday weekend bump. I think what we're seeing with this and P2 products is a new release doing really well around the time of its lauch and pushing down basic book sales. Back in the day, new books always had very strong sales the first week and month and then declined. Wildemount and Gamemastery guide both surpased thier core books this month. The PHB has gained back some ground but will likely still fluctuate a bit and with Wildemount release, I think it will be at the top for at least a few weeks longer. The 5th ed books overall for the last week have pretty much held steady. What has really surprised me is what's happening with the Paizo books. That's where coronavirus may have hit hardest (of the two brands). The core book is down in the 8000s and reached a new low in the 9000s. The Gamemastery Guide is also down in that 8000 range, too. That's a pretty big drop in a week. Maybe this is where shipping difficulties are hurting sales, or possibly people who are self isolating are mostly buying 5th ed because it's easier to find online games. I don't know if any stores buy stock on Amazon. Whether or not, Paizo Amazon sales, according to one calculator I use, are at the level where a few less purchases each day or month will push the ranking down. [/QUOTE]
